## Further Reading

The N+1 fix in the Quillbore GraphQL layer replaced per-field resolver calls with batched loaders. If you touch anything under the orders schema, read the batching notes first — the loader cache is request-scoped and easy to break. Benchmarks before and after are in the perf folder; the short version is 40x fewer queries on the storefront page. Don't add new resolvers without a loader. The full write-up, including the dataloader patterns we standardized on, lives on the internal wiki here:

operations page: https://jenkins.zemvarcloud.local/job/merge_requests/repo/build/73930b4b30f0a8ed

## Dispatcho Environments

Quick map for support folks: Dispatcho runs the driver-assignment heuristic in three environments — sandbox, staging, and prod. Sandbox uses fake drivers and assigns basically at random, so don't panic if routes look silly there. Staging mirrors prod traffic at ten percent and runs the real scoring weights. If a customer reports weird assignments, always check which environment the tenant lives in first. For reference, prod currently runs the heuristic with these values.

config for bawig-fadup:
[zorix]
host = zorix.lumicworks.corp
user = zorix_svc
database = zorix_prod

// HEADS-UP for security review: this constant caps per-transaction
// rounding drift in the Lumenpay converter. Anything above half a
// minor unit gets flagged, since stacked conversions through the
// Drakmar gateway once accumulated visible cents. Don't loosen it
// without re-running the fuzz suite. The audited build carrying
// this value is recorded by the token below.

pipeline stamp: htk9_ce63042d9